cuda.live
  • Home
    • CUDA C++
    • Triton
  • Playground
  • Challenges
  • Gallery
  • Pricing
Tutorial
  • 0Installing CUDA
  • 1Introduction to CUDA
  • 2Programming Model
  • 3Memory Management
  • 4Kernels & Execution
  • 5Synchronization
  • 6Streams & Concurrency
  • 7Performance Optimization
Additional Resources
  • DDocuments
  • VVideos
Playground
  • ⌨Code Playground

CUDA Videos

Curated talks and walkthroughs for seeing CUDA concepts explained by NVIDIA engineers and practitioners.

Official video

Getting Started with CUDA and Parallel Programming

NVIDIA GTC session on the fundamentals of parallel programming with CUDA.

Watch video →
Official video

1,001 Ways to Accelerate Python with CUDA Kernels

NVIDIA GTC session on kernel structure, memory, and optimization techniques.

Watch video →

⚠️ NVIDIA has not reviewed, approved, or authorized the content on this website. cuda.live is an independent educational resource and is not affiliated with, endorsed by, or sponsored by NVIDIA Corporation. CUDA® is used here solely for descriptive/reference purposes to identify the technology being taught. This use is not intended to suggest any affiliation with or endorsement by NVIDIA Corporation. The use of "CUDA" in this domain name is for nominative fair use purposes — to describe the subject matter of these educational tutorials, not to imply sponsorship. CUDA® and NVIDIA® are registered trademarks of NVIDIA Corporation. All other trademarks are the property of their respective owners. Full legal notice →

© 2026 cuda.live. Content is for educational purposes only.
LegalPrivacyTerms